What Are Online Homeschool Programmes?

Online homeschool programmes are structured educational systems that allow children to study from home through virtual classrooms, digital platforms, and online resources. Unlike traditional homeschooling, where parents design and teach lessons themselves, online homeschool programmes provide qualified teachers, complete curricula, assessments, and academic support. This is to enable them to suit the needs of families which prefer the advantages of home schooling but not having to struggle in teaching all the subjects by themselves.

These programmes normally adhere to national or international recognised curriculum, including the British National Curriculum, IGCSE pathway, or to other approved curricula. Online learning students access online education platforms, participate in real-time classes or view recorded classes, do their assignments digitally, and engage in interactive learning. The academic experience is provided by the means of a well-organised system of virtual tools that allow giving the academic quality and provide unprecedented flexibility to daily lessons, teacher feedback and assessments.

For families who travel frequently, live abroad, or prefer the safety and comfort of home, online homeschool programmes offer stability and continuity. Students will not have to think about switching schools, adjusting to new conditions, or classroom distractions. They instead have the benefit of a personalised learning experience that is in a consistent manner regardless of location.

How Online Homeschool Programmes Work

Online homeschool programmes combine professional teaching, structured curricula, and digital learning technology to deliver a complete educational experience. Learning is also common among students who use a safe online portal where they can attend classes live, access their materials, make their assignments and communicate with their teachers. Most of the programmes have weekly schedules, academic planners, and inbuilt progress monitoring solutions to ensure that the students get organised.

The experience typically consists of:

  • Real-time virtual classes through educators.
  • Videotaped lectures with revisioning or LMS.
  • E-textbooks, home study learning materials.
  • Homework tasks and papers through the Internet.
  • The feedback of teachers and the individual support via video calls or messages.
  • Quizzes, breakout rooms or group discussions are examples of interactive activities.
  • Other extracurricular activities such as clubs, competitions, and online events.

Parents can find academic reports, attendance data, and insights on the progress and play an active role, but they do not need to transform into a teacher. Such a balanced format offers the two-fold solution: the mentorship of professional teachers and the ease of learning at home.

Challenges of Online Homeschooling

Although online homeschooling possesses numerous strengths, there are challenges that it has. Screen time is one of the popular issues. When students invest hours on the internet, they are likely to get fatigued and that is why the majority of the reputable programmes include frequent breaks, physical exercising and healthy screen time.

The other problem is social interaction. Children can be denied the social component of conventional education such as group activities or direct friendship. Nevertheless, virtual clubs, social gatherings, group work, and real-life events are some of the online schools that provide opportunities to students to establish meaningful relationships.

The third challenge is self-discipline. Certain students might be motivated by not being in the presence of supervision. This is where there are organised online programmes which include classes live, teachers support and patterns, which makes a big change.

These challenges can be addressed with the guidance of trained teachers, a conducive timetable, and with the assistance of the other family members.

How do assessments work in online homeschool programmes?

Quizzes, assignments, and projects are done online by students. Formal assessment examinations such as IGCSEs or A-Levels are done at accredited examination centres. Regular progress reports and feedback are given by the teachers to keep the families informed.
